#define Min(a,b) ( ((a)>=(b))?(b):(a)) 一定要注意加括号
如果不加括号 处理一些运算符比较麻烦
本文介绍了一个使用宏定义实现的最小值函数,并强调了在宏定义中正确使用括号的重要性,以确保运算符的优先级得到正确处理。
#define Min(a,b) ( ((a)>=(b))?(b):(a)) 一定要注意加括号
如果不加括号 处理一些运算符比较麻烦
3113
941

被折叠的 条评论
为什么被折叠?